FTC Release: Federal Trade Commission Warns Companies to Comply with "Made in USA" Requirements

Dow Jones
Jul 16, 2025

Today, the Federal Trade Commission sent warning letters to four companies who claim their consumer goods are of U.S. origin, reminding them to comply with the FTC's "Made in USA" requirements. Additionally, the FTC sent letters to Amazon and Walmart regarding third-party sellers who appear to be making deceptive "Made in USA" claims about their products on those online marketplaces.
